***** Retailer Announcement *****
INFINITI is updating the previously announced quality hold (PC609) from January 11, 2018 and is now
instructing retailers to reprogram Electronic Power Steering (EPS) software to the most current
production level on 514 specific 2018 Q60 RWD Sport and RWD Red Sport vehicles equipped with
EPS. A new campaign ID (P8301) has been assigned to differentiate which vehicles have received
updated software. This campaign ID will replace PC609 in Service Comm and DBS National Service
History on January 20, 2018.
***** What Retailers Should Do *****
PLEASE FOLLOW THE ATTACHED REPAIR INSTRUCTIONS:
1. Verify if vehicles are affected by this quality action using Service Comm or DBS National Service
History – Open Campaign I.D. P8301
 New vehicles in retailer inventory can also be identified using DCS (Sales-> Vehicle Inventory,
and filter by Open Campaign).
 Refer to IPSB 15-286 for additional information
 Please continue to check newly arriving inventory for quality action applicability.
2. Please do not drive, sell, or trade the specific 2018 Q60 vehicles in retailer inventory subject to this
quality action until the updated software has been installed.
3. Use the attached procedure to install the updated software.
4. The service department should submit the applicable warranty claim for the action performed so it
can be closed on Service Comm and release the vehicle.
***** Retailer Responsibility *****
It is the retailer’s responsibility to check Service Comm or DBS National Service History – Open
Campaigns using the appropriate campaign I.D for the quality action status on each affected vehicle
currently in new vehicle inventory. INFINITI requires retailers to perform this repair on applicable new
vehicles in inventory prior to being retailed to ensure client satisfaction.

P8301 2018 Q60 (CV37)
ELECTRONIC POWER STEERING
(EPS) REPROGRAMMING
IMPORTANT: This repair procedure will reprogram the Electronic Power Steering (EPS).
Make sure to follow all the steps in the specific order listed to properly
complete the repair.
SERVICE PROCEDURE
IMPORTANT:

The “Shipping Mode” must be turned OFF (White Storage Switch PUSHED-IN) to
complete the EPS Reprogramming.
NOTE:

After reprogramming is complete, you will be required to perform DTC erase.
1. Open the Driver Door.
Figure 1
Storage
Switch
2. Verify the vehicle is out of “Shipping Mode”.


Remove the fuse box cover on
the Driver kick panel.
Push-in the Storage Switch
(White Square Button).
Fuse Box
Cover
Figure 2
3. Connect the plus Vehicle Interface (plus VI) to the vehicle.

Make sure to use the correct VI for C-III plus (plus VI).
CAUTION: Make sure the plus VI is securly connected. If the plus VI connection is loose
during reprogramming, the process will be interrupted and the EPS may be damaged.
4. Connect the AC Adaptor to the CONSULT PC.
CAUTION: Be sure to connect the AC Adaptor. If the CONSULT PC battery voltage drops
during reprogramming, the process will be interrupted and the EPS may be damaged.
5. Connect the GR8 (battery charger) to the vehicle 12V battery.

Set the GR8 to the ECM power supply mode..
CAUTION: Be sure the battery charger is connected securely to the battery. Make sure
the battery voltage stays between 12.0V and 15.5V during reprogramming. If the battery
voltage goes out of this range during reprogramming, the EPS may be damaged.
6. Turn off all external Bluetooth® devices (e.g., cell phones, printers, etc.) within range of the
CONSULT PC and the VI.
CAUTION: Make sure to turn off all external Bluetooth® devices. If Bluetooth® signal
waves are within range of the CONSULT PC and the VI during reprogramming,
reprogramming may be interrupted and the EPS may be damaged.
7. Turn the ignition ON with the engine OFF.

The engine must not start or run during the reprogramming procedure.
8. Turn OFF all vehicle electrical loads such as exterior lights, interior lights, HVAC, blower, rear
defogger, audio, NAVI, seat heater, steering wheel heater, etc.
IMPORTANT: Make sure to turn OFF all vehicle electrical loads. Make sure the battery
voltage stays between 12.0V and 15.5V during reprogramming. If the battery voltage goes
out of this range during reprogramming, the EPS may be damaged.
9. Turn ON the CONSULT PC.
